"""Site resource manager for VergeOS backup/DR operations."""
from __future__ import annotations
import builtins
from datetime import datetime, timezone
from typing import TYPE_CHECKING, Any
from pyvergeos.exceptions import NotFoundError, ValidationError
from pyvergeos.filters import build_filter
from pyvergeos.resources.base import ResourceManager, ResourceObject
if TYPE_CHECKING:
from pyvergeos.client import VergeClient
# Default fields for site list operations
_DEFAULT_SITE_FIELDS = [
"$key",
"name",
"description",
"enabled",
"url",
"domain",
"city",
"country",
"timezone",
"latitude",
"longitude",
"status",
"status_info",
"authentication_status",
"config_cloud_snapshots",
"config_statistics",
"config_management",
"config_repair_server",
"vsan_host",
"vsan_port",
"is_tenant",
"incoming_syncs_enabled",
"outgoing_syncs_enabled",
"statistics_interval",
"statistics_retention",
"created",
"modified",
"creator",
]
[docs]
class Site(ResourceObject):
"""Site resource object representing a connection to a remote VergeOS system.
Sites are used for disaster recovery, replication, and remote management
between VergeOS systems.
Properties:
name: Site name.
description: Site description.
is_enabled: Whether the site is enabled.
url: URL of the remote VergeOS system.
domain: Domain name for the site.
city: City where the site is located.
country: Country code where the site is located.
timezone: Timezone for the site.
latitude: Geographic latitude.
longitude: Geographic longitude.
status: Site status (idle, authenticating, syncing, error, warning).
status_info: Additional status information.
authentication_status: Authentication status (unauthenticated, authenticated, legacy).
config_cloud_snapshots: Cloud snapshot sync config (disabled, send, receive, both).
config_statistics: Statistics sync config (disabled, send, receive, both).
config_management: Machine management config (disabled, manage, managed, both).
config_repair_server: Repair server config (disabled, send, receive, both).
vsan_host: vSAN connection host.
vsan_port: vSAN connection port.
is_tenant: Whether site is a tenant.
has_incoming_syncs: Whether incoming syncs are enabled.
has_outgoing_syncs: Whether outgoing syncs are enabled.
statistics_interval: Statistics sync interval in seconds.
statistics_retention: Statistics retention period in seconds.
created_at: When the site was created.
modified_at: When the site was last modified.
creator: Username who created the site.
"""

[docs]
class SiteManager(ResourceManager[Site]):
"""Manager for site operations.
Sites represent connections to other VergeOS systems for disaster recovery,
replication, and remote management.
Example:
>>> # List all sites
>>> sites = client.sites.list()
>>> # Create a new site
>>> site = client.sites.create(
... name="DR-Site",
... url="https://dr.example.com",
... username="admin",
... password="secret",
... config_cloud_snapshots="send",
... )
>>> # Get a site by name
>>> site = client.sites.get(name="DR-Site")
>>> # Enable/disable a site
>>> site = client.sites.enable(site.key)
>>> site = client.sites.disable(site.key)
>>> # Delete a site
>>> client.sites.delete(site.key)
"""
_endpoint = "sites"
[docs]
def __init__(self, client: VergeClient) -> None:
super().__init__(client)
def _to_model(self, data: dict[str, Any]) -> Site:
return Site(data, self)
[docs]
def list(
self,
filter: str | None = None,
fields: builtins.list[str] | None = None,
limit: int | None = None,
offset: int | None = None,
*,
enabled: bool | None = None,
status: str | None = None,
**filter_kwargs: Any,
) -> builtins.list[Site]:
"""List sites.
Args:
filter: OData filter string.
fields: List of fields to return.
limit: Maximum number of results.
offset: Skip this many results.
enabled: Filter by enabled status.
status: Filter by status (idle, authenticating, syncing, error, warning).
**filter_kwargs: Additional filter arguments.
Returns:
List of Site objects sorted by name.
Example:
>>> # All sites
>>> sites = client.sites.list()
>>> # Enabled sites only
>>> sites = client.sites.list(enabled=True)
>>> # Sites with errors
>>> sites = client.sites.list(status="error")
"""
conditions: builtins.list[str] = []
if enabled is not None:
conditions.append(f"enabled eq {str(enabled).lower()}")
if status is not None:
conditions.append(f"status eq '{status}'")
if filter:
conditions.append(f"({filter})")
if filter_kwargs:
conditions.append(build_filter(**filter_kwargs))
combined_filter = " and ".join(conditions) if conditions else None
if fields is None:
fields = _DEFAULT_SITE_FIELDS
params: dict[str, Any] = {}
if combined_filter:
params["filter"] = combined_filter
if fields:
params["fields"] = ",".join(fields)
if limit is not None:
params["limit"] = limit
if offset is not None:
params["offset"] = offset
params["sort"] = "+name"
response = self._client._request("GET", self._endpoint, params=params)
if response is None:
return []
if not isinstance(response, list):
return [self._to_model(response)]
return [self._to_model(item) for item in response]

[docs]
def create( # type: ignore[override]
self,
name: str,
url: str,
username: str,
password: str,
*,
description: str | None = None,
allow_insecure: bool = False,
config_cloud_snapshots: str = "disabled",
config_statistics: str = "disabled",
config_management: str = "disabled",
config_repair_server: str = "disabled",
auto_create_syncs: bool = True,
domain: str | None = None,
city: str | None = None,
country: str | None = None,
timezone: str | None = None,
request_url: str | None = None,
) -> Site:
"""Create a new site connection.
Args:
name: Site name.
url: URL of the remote VergeOS system.
username: Username for authentication.
password: Password for authentication.
description: Optional site description.
allow_insecure: Allow insecure SSL connections (for self-signed certs).
config_cloud_snapshots: Cloud snapshot config (disabled, send, receive, both).
config_statistics: Statistics config (disabled, send, receive, both).
config_management: Management config (disabled, manage, managed, both).
config_repair_server: Repair server config (disabled, send, receive, both).
auto_create_syncs: Automatically create sync configurations.
domain: Domain name for the site.
city: City where the site is located.
country: Country code where the site is located.
timezone: Timezone for the site.
request_url: URL the remote system uses to connect back.
Returns:
Created Site object.
Raises:
ValidationError: If invalid parameters.
APIError: If creation fails.
Example:
>>> site = client.sites.create(
... name="DR-Site",
... url="https://dr.example.com",
... username="admin",
... password="secret",
... config_cloud_snapshots="send",
... allow_insecure=True,
... )
"""
# Validate URL format
if not url.startswith(("http://", "https://")):
raise ValidationError("URL must start with http:// or https://")
# Validate config values
valid_sync_configs = {"disabled", "send", "receive", "both"}
valid_management_configs = {"disabled", "manage", "managed", "both"}
if config_cloud_snapshots not in valid_sync_configs:
raise ValidationError(f"config_cloud_snapshots must be one of: {valid_sync_configs}")
if config_statistics not in valid_sync_configs:
raise ValidationError(f"config_statistics must be one of: {valid_sync_configs}")
if config_management not in valid_management_configs:
raise ValidationError(f"config_management must be one of: {valid_management_configs}")
if config_repair_server not in valid_sync_configs:
raise ValidationError(f"config_repair_server must be one of: {valid_sync_configs}")
# Build request body
body: dict[str, Any] = {
"name": name,
"url": url,
"auth_user": username,
"auth_password": password,
"enabled": True,
"allow_insecure": allow_insecure,
"config_cloud_snapshots": config_cloud_snapshots,
"config_statistics": config_statistics,
"config_management": config_management,
"config_repair_server": config_repair_server,
"automatically_create_syncs": auto_create_syncs,
}
if description:
body["description"] = description
if domain:
body["domain"] = domain
if city:
body["city"] = city
if country:
body["country"] = country
if timezone:
body["timezone"] = timezone
if request_url:
body["request_url"] = request_url
response = self._client._request("POST", self._endpoint, json_data=body)
if response is None:
raise ValueError("No response from create operation")
if not isinstance(response, dict):
raise ValueError("Create operation returned invalid response")
site_key = response.get("$key")
if site_key:
return self.get(int(site_key))
return self._to_model(response)

[docs]
def reauthenticate(self, key: int, username: str, password: str) -> Site:
"""Reauthenticate with a remote site.
Use this to update credentials or resolve authentication issues.
Args:
key: Site $key (ID).
username: Username for authentication.
password: Password for authentication.
Returns:
Updated Site object.
"""
body: dict[str, Any] = {
"site": key,
"action": "reauthenticate",
"params": {
"auth_user": username,
"auth_password": password,
},
}
self._client._request("POST", "site_actions", json_data=body)
return self.get(key)
